Farve problem

Tags:    html css

Hej,
Jeg har et problem med farverne i html/css - jeg prøver at få lavet dette design.
Men da jeg kører Mac med firefox som client, opstår der nogle problemer med farverne.
Det kan ses på dette screenshot.

Det skal rigtigt se sådan her ud.



Indlæg senest redigeret d. 02.03.2010 12:40 af Bruger #6952
Jeg kan ikke se hvad forskellen er i farverne. Kan du beskrive det nærmere?



Hvis du kigger på billedet her kan du se en lyseblå farve i bunden, som du ikke kan se på dette billede her - det sidste billede her er sådan som det skal se ud.


Og her til sidst er der et billede af hvordan det også skal se ud - her er det bare i firefox på en windows 7 maskine (Her ser det altså rigtigt ud - uden farveskift som der er på det første billede)



Indlæg senest redigeret d. 02.03.2010 15:35 af Bruger #6952
Jeg vil gætte på at det er fordi baggrundsbilledet er gemt med en Color Profile, og at dit styresystem samtidigt kender din skærms Color Profile. Når begge disse profiler eksisterer, vil Color Management i Firefox ændre farverne på billedet matchende forskellen i de to profiler, således at farverne i billedet kommer til at fremstå mere præcist som de var tiltænkt. Hvis det er tilfældet vil problemet kunne løses ved at slette den Color Profile der er gemt i baggrundsbilledet. Jeg ved ikke hvordan man fjerner farveprofiler fra JPEG-billeder.



Men nu er det jo ikke billedet der bliver en forkert farve, men baggrundsfarven, som er angivet ved background-color:#0d40b3; i min body - det sjove er jo bare at på min mac er den background color en helt anden end på min pc.



Jeg kender godt til problemet, og kender ikke helt til en rigtig teknisk løsning. Så lytter selv lidt med på denne tråd.

Men jeg kender til en rigtig let og godt lappe metode. Lad baggrunden bare være et 1*1px billede som har fordoblet i både y og x aksen. Det kan let gøres med css.



Indlæg senest redigeret d. 02.03.2010 17:41 af Bruger #5097
Ok, så er det ikke det der er problemet. Jeg har aldrig hørt om før at baggrundsfarven bliver forkert. CSS farver er ikke en del af Color Management.

På min Firefox 3.6, Windows Vista, ThinkPad vises baggrundsfarven korrekt.



Theis: Ja det har jeg også tænkt på at gøre, men hvordan ville jeg kunne gøre det under det andet baggrundsbillede jeg bruger?
Min csskode til body ser sådan her ud:
Fold kodeboks ind/udKode 

Og efter din "model" skal jeg jo nu bruge 2 baggrunde i en body, hvordan gør jeg dette? Kan umiddelbart ikke lige se en løsning selv.

Jesper: Ja, det virker ret underligt at de ikke kører samme farve i alle browsere.




Du skal bare lave endnu en div, hvor du også i denne div vælger en baggrund. Prøv at tjekke denne side:
http://jobs.webdesignerwall.com/

Eller tjek eventuelt denne side, hvor de netop beskriver den jeg linker til:
http://www.webdesignerwall.com/tutorials/how-to-css-large-background/



Ahh, smart! Mange tak for hjælpen, har fundet ud af at få det til at se godt ud nu :) - gjorde det at jeg lavede en 1px*1px jpeg med den farve jeg skulle bruge, og sat den som background, med en div med billede-baggrunden over :)
Endnu engang tak for hjælpen. (Dog er det stadig underligt at farverne ikke er de samme!)



t